When was JUMER PROPERTIES LTD founded?
JUMER PROPERTIES LTD was officially incorporated on 21 September 2020 and is registered under company number 12894040.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.
What type of company is JUMER PROPERTIES LTD?
Private Limited Company. This classification indicates the legal structure of the company, which determines the way it is governed, its liability, and regulatory obligations. A private limited company (Ltd) limits the personal liability of its shareholders.
What is the current status of JUMER PROPERTIES LTD?
JUMER PROPERTIES LTD's current status is Active. The company status indicates whether it is actively trading, dormant, or has been dissolved. Maintaining an active status is essential for legally conducting business, filing accounts, and maintaining credibility with partners and lenders.
What does JUMER PROPERTIES LTD do?
JUMER PROPERTIES LTD operates in the following sector: 68209 - Other letting and operating of own or leased real estate.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.
What is JUMER PROPERTIES LTD's registered address?
The registered office address of JUMER PROPERTIES LTD is GOODRIDGE COURT, GOODRIDGE AVENUE, GLOUCESTER, GLOUCESTERSHIRE, ENGLAND, GL2 5EN. This is the official address filed with Companies House for legal and statutory correspondence.
Is JUMER PROPERTIES LTD financially stable?
The most recent accounts for JUMER PROPERTIES LTD were made up to 30 September 2025, filed as UNAUDITED ABRIDGED. Next accounts are due by 30 June 2027.
Does JUMER PROPERTIES LTD have any charges or mortgages?
JUMER PROPERTIES LTD has 5 registered charges, of which 5 are outstanding, 0 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
